The video tutorial outlines the progression of COVID-19 symptoms, starting with initial signs like cough and fatigue. By day five, patients may experience breathing difficulties, especially those with preexisting conditions. Hospitalization typically occurs around seven days after fever onset. By day eight, severe cases may develop ARDS, a potentially fatal condition. By day ten, patients with worsening symptoms are often admitted to the ICU, experiencing additional issues like abdominal pain and loss of appetite.
